Feeling the bond.
In the realm where the sun meets the sea,
Where whispers of fate dance wild and free,
Lies the tale of a heart named Kajira,
Meant for a soul as vast as its era.
Once owned by one with a heart so cold,
A soul that loved not, a spirit so bold,
But the stars in their silent throng,
Sang of a love that would soon belong.
On a path paved with tears and with might,
I walked, guided by love's gentle light,
Seeking a bond that would never decay,
Along the same trail where we'd lay.
Then in the shadow of the moon's soft glow,
I found you, my heart's true echo,
Our eyes met, and time took a pause,
In that moment, I knew the cause.
Kajira, once lost to the night,
Found in your warmth, a new spark of light,
The wrong hands had held you so tight,
Yet destiny had drawn us together so right.

Silent Screams
by Jules Terry
3/21/2025
In shadows cast by dreams you chase,
I wear a mask, I lose my grace.
Your hopes entwine, they pull me tight,
While inside me, storms brew with might.
You seek a smile, a perfect role,
But in this script, I lose my soul.
I long to break from gilded chains,
Yet silence wraps me, fills with pains.
Expectations weigh, they twist and bind,
A battle rages deep within my mind.
Oh can't you see, we're worlds apart,
Your dreams hold me, yet break my heart.
I wish to breathe, to find my way,
But every "please" keeps me at bay.
So hear my silent, aching plea,
Let me be more than what you see.
I won't be silent!
by Jules Terry
3/22/2025
A tide that is taking me under,
Swallowing sand, left with nothing to say.
My voice drowned out in the thunder,
But I won’t cry and I won’t start to sway.
Whenever they try to silence my song,
I stand tall, determined to stay strong.
Caught in the waves, pressure building inside,
Yet deep in my heart, there’s a fire I ride.
With every harsh whisper that sweeps through the air,
I gather my courage, refusing despair.
Their attempts to cut me or drown out my light,
Only fuel my spirit, igniting the fight.
I won’t be faint-hearted, I won’t be afraid,
For the truth in my words will never degrade.
Though shadows may loom and the storms may arise,
I’ll rise from the depths to claim my own skies.
With the power of dreams and the strength of my will,
I’ll carve out a path, unyielding and still.
For silence is shackles that hold many tight,
But my voice breaks the chains, a beacon of light.
So listen, dear world, as I speak my own name,
For I am the storm, I refuse to be tame.
Like waves crashing fiercely upon rocky shore,
I’m unbreakable spirit, forever I’ll roar.
In the depths of the darkness where fears try to creep,
I’ll shine through the struggles, the promise I keep.
With every heartbeat, a rhythm so clear,
My song finds its way, full of courage and cheer.
I won't be silenced, my spirit won't fall,
With each rising tide, I’ll stand proud and tall.
So let the winds howl and the thunder resound,
In the depths of my soul, my strength can be found.
Forever I’ll speak, let my voice be my guide,
Through the storms and the silence, I won't turn aside.
